How Our Under Carpet Water Extraction Process Works
When you call us for Under Carpet Water Extraction, you’re not just getting a bunch of technicians in a hazmat suit. You’re getting a team that knows exactly what to do, every step of the way. Our process is designed to get the water out, dry your carpet, and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a technician to your home to assess the damage and come up with a plan to get the water out. This is where the magic happens – our techs use specialized equipment to find the source of the leak and start extracting water.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ible from your carpet and subfloor. This is the most critical part of the process – the faster we get the water out, the less damage there will be.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is gone,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your carpet and subfloor. This includes dehumidifiers and air movers that work together to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ect your carpet and subfloor to remove any remaining moisture and pr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Under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ak, less than 1 inch of water | Yes | No | You can likely handle it yourself with a wet vacuum and some towels. |
| Large leak, more than 1 inch of water | No | Yes | You need professional equ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to multiple rooms | No | Yes | You need a team to handle the cleanup and restoration. |
| Hidden water damage (e.g. Behind walls) |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ment to find and fix the issue. |
| Water damage to expensive or sentimental items | No | Yes | You need professional care to prevent further damage and restore your items. |
| Water damage to a home with a history of flooding | No | Yes | You need expert advice to prevent further damage and ensure your home is safe. |

Under Carpet Water Extraction Cost In Loma Linda, CA
The cost of Under Carpet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Loma Linda,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ges to give you an idea of what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water present.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ture present.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ination. |
| Equipment Rental | $50 – $200 | The type and duration of equipment rental. |
| Travel Fee | $25 – $100 | The distance from our office to your location. |
| More Services (e.g. Mold remediation) | $500 – $2,000 | The scope and complexity of the more service. |
Keep in mind that these are just estimates – the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and the specific services required.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an and budget.
